Page 30, Section 9.02, replace the existing Section 9.02 with the
following language:
Reimbursement rates for corrective lenses and frames are based
on the Board's designated corrective lenses and frames service
provider, Costco, and will be reviewed every two years. Any claim
submitted by a member who chooses not use the LEOFF Board
designated corrective lenses and frames service provider or lives
outside the service area may be limited to reimbursement up to
what the designated corrective lenses and frames service provider
would charge.
A. Lenses and Frames.
1. Active LEOFF 1 Members
Vision insurance coverage is provided for active
LEOFF 1 members through Vision Service Plan. If
any balance remains after Vision Service Plan, or any
other vision plan the LEOFF I member is enrolled in,
has paid its benefit, the member should forward a
copy of the Explanation of Benefits statement
together with a completed Corrective Lenses and
Frames Worksheet to the LEOFF Board for
consideration. The LEOFF Board may reimburse up
to the amounts described below. The reimbursement
rates apply after all insurance coverages have been
applied. Any balance due after the LEOFF Board
reimbursement is the responsibility of the LEOFF I
member.

Page 30, Section 9.02, create a new paragraph "B" entitled "Laser
Vision Correction" to read as follows:
"The Board will reimburse the member the amount of $700 per eye
for Radial Keratotomy (RK) surgery or laser eye sur.qery (LASIK
and RK). If a member is reimbursed the $700 per eye for the
surgery, he or she will not be reimbursed for eye.qlasses or contact
lenses durin.q the subsequent two calendar years, unless
eyeglasses or contact lenses are medically necessary."
Page 33, Section 9.05(A)(6), change the provision to read: "The
Board will not reimburse for home health care provided by an
individual who ordinarily resides in the member's home, or is a
member of the family of either the member or the member's
spouse, unless the individual is a licensed home health care
provider.
